HGL
eastern-cyan
Tyranny
I was hoping to run Tyranny, and it launches… but Legendary throws an error, and the game itself is stuck on a purple screen. Any suggestions?
This is the error when I launch the game:
An error has occurred! Try to Logout and Login on your Epic account.
Traceback (most recent call last):
File "legendary/cli.py", line 3061, in <module>File "legendary/cli.py", line 2976, in main
File "legendary/cli.py", line 608, in launch_game
File "legendary/core.py", line 701, in get_launch_parameters
File "legendary/core.py", line 633, in get_app_launch_commandIndexError: list index out of range
[93835] Failed to execute script 'cli' due to unhandled exception!
An error has occurred! Try to Logout and Login on your Epic account.
Traceback (most recent call last):
File "legendary/cli.py", line 3061, in <module>File "legendary/cli.py", line 2976, in main
File "legendary/cli.py", line 608, in launch_game
File "legendary/core.py", line 701, in get_launch_parameters
File "legendary/core.py", line 633, in get_app_launch_commandIndexError: list index out of range
[93835] Failed to execute script 'cli' due to unhandled exception!
2 Replies
You can ignore the error message (it happens when a command related to launching the game is ran, but it failing doesn't affect the actual game launch)
Send in the game log
eastern-cyanOP•2y ago
This?
Game Settings: {
"autoInstallDxvk": true,
"autoInstallVkd3d": true,
"preferSystemLibs": false,
"nvidiaPrime": false,
"enviromentOptions": [],
"wrapperOptions": [],
"showFps": false,
"useGameMode": false,
"language": "",
"wineVersion": {
"wineserver":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/bin/wineserver",
"lib":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ib",
"lib32":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ib",
"bin":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/bin/wine64",
"name": "Wine Crossover - 22.1.1",
"type": "wine"
},
"wineCrossoverBottle": "Heroic",
"winePrefix": "/Users/user/Games/Heroic/Prefixes/Tyranny - Gold Edition"
}
Game launched at: Tue Jul 04 2023 00:19:45 GMT-0400 (Eastern Daylight Time)
Legendary's config from config.ini (before App's settings):
SyntaxError: Unexpected end of JSON input
Launch Command: LD_PRELOAD= WINEPREFIX="/Users/user/Games/Heroic/Prefixes/Tyranny - Gold Edition" WINEDLLOVERRIDES=winemenubuilder.exe=d ORIG_LD_LIBRARY_PATH= LD_LIBRARY_PATH="/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ib:/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ib" WINEDLLPATH="/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ib/wine:/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ib/wine" /Applications/Heroic.app/Contents/Resources/app.asar.unpacked/build/bin/darwin/legendary launch 36b0e40890f147fbb1e3965f87369156 --language en --wine "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/bin/wine64"
Game Log:
[cli] INFO: Logging in...
[Core] INFO: Trying to re-use existing login session...
[cli] INFO: Checking for updates...
[Core] INFO: Getting authentication token...
[cli] INFO: Launching 36b0e40890f147fbb1e3965f87369156...
Legendary update available!
- New version: 0.20.33 - "Undue Alarm"
- Release summary:
[*] Improved handling of SDL changes
[*] Added safeguards to prevent two simultaneous instances from corrupting the database
[*] Added support for running uninstallers
[*] More gracefully handles account errors
See full changelog for additional details.
- Release URL: https://legendary.gl/release/0.20.33
- Download URL: https://legendary.gl/release/download/0.20.33/legendary_macOS.zip
preloader: Warning: failed to reserve range 0000000000010000-0000000000110000
wine client error:0: version mismatch 763/755.
Your wine binary was not upgraded correctly,
or you have an older one somewhere in your PATH.
Or maybe the wrong wineserver is still running?
Game Settings: {
"autoInstallDxvk": true,
"autoInstallVkd3d": true,
"preferSystemLibs": false,
"nvidiaPrime": false,
"enviromentOptions": [],
"wrapperOptions": [],
"showFps": false,
"useGameMode": false,
"language": "",
"wineVersion": {
"wineserver":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/bin/wineserver",
"lib":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ib",
"lib32":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ib",
"bin": "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/bin/wine64",
"name": "Wine Crossover - 22.1.1",
"type": "wine"
},
"wineCrossoverBottle": "Heroic",
"winePrefix": "/Users/user/Games/Heroic/Prefixes/Tyranny - Gold Edition"
}
Game launched at: Tue Jul 04 2023 00:19:45 GMT-0400 (Eastern Daylight Time)
Legendary's config from config.ini (before App's settings):
SyntaxError: Unexpected end of JSON input
Launch Command: LD_PRELOAD= WINEPREFIX="/Users/user/Games/Heroic/Prefixes/Tyranny - Gold Edition" WINEDLLOVERRIDES=winemenubuilder.exe=d ORIG_LD_LIBRARY_PATH= LD_LIBRARY_PATH="/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ib:/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ib" WINEDLLPATH="/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ib/wine:/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/lib/wine" /Applications/Heroic.app/Contents/Resources/app.asar.unpacked/build/bin/darwin/legendary launch 36b0e40890f147fbb1e3965f87369156 --language en --wine "/Users/user/Library/Application Support/heroic/tools/wine/Wine-Crossover-latest/Contents/Resources/wine/bin/wine64"
Game Log:
[cli] INFO: Logging in...
[Core] INFO: Trying to re-use existing login session...
[cli] INFO: Checking for updates...
[Core] INFO: Getting authentication token...
[cli] INFO: Launching 36b0e40890f147fbb1e3965f87369156...
Legendary update available!
- New version: 0.20.33 - "Undue Alarm"
- Release summary:
[*] Improved handling of SDL changes
[*] Added safeguards to prevent two simultaneous instances from corrupting the database
[*] Added support for running uninstallers
[*] More gracefully handles account errors
See full changelog for additional details.
- Release URL: https://legendary.gl/release/0.20.33
- Download URL: https://legendary.gl/release/download/0.20.33/legendary_macOS.zip
preloader: Warning: failed to reserve range 0000000000010000-0000000000110000
wine client error:0: version mismatch 763/755.
Your wine binary was not upgraded correctly,
or you have an older one somewhere in your PATH.
Or maybe the wrong wineserver is still running?